I'll leave the question of marketability of a huacaya out of two suris to those dedicated to huacayas and speak to the issue of the suri with the huacaya on the pedigree. It has become increasingly difficult to market such suris and thus this sector of the market seems to have softened the fastest and the farthest. The stigma (right wrong or indifferent) associated with having a huacaya on a suri pedigree has only grown in recent years.

Just something to keep in mind when looking for suris. If the quality out weights the pedigree it might be a great deal. As long as you go into it with your eyes open.
